Year-Round Color in Your Arizona Landscape: The Ultimate Planting Guide
Living in Arizona means embracing the beauty of the desert—towering saguaros, golden sunsets, and, with the right plant choices, a landscape bursting with color in every season. If you’re tired of the same few plants contractors use and want a vibrant yard all year, we’ve got you covered.
This planting guide highlights ten stunning desert-adapted plants that not only thrive in full sun but also ensure your outdoor space stays colorful no matter the season.
Winter Wonders: Blooming When You Least Expect It
Cascalote Tree (Caesalpinia cacalaco) – This evergreen tree bursts into bright yellow flowers in winter, adding warmth to cooler months.
Parry’s Penstemon (Penstemon parryi) – A perennial favorite with pink blooms from winter to spring, attracting hummingbirds.
Lilac Vine (Hardenbergia violaceae) – This evergreen vine dazzles with purple flowers from mid-winter to early spring, perfect for covering trellises and walls.
Valentine Bush (Eremophila maculata) – True to its name, this evergreen shrub blooms red to fuchsia flowers in late winter through mid-spring—just in time for Valentine’s Day!
Green Feathery Cassia (Senna artemisioides filifolia) – With delicate foliage and yellow flowers from late winter to early summer, this plant provides extended seasonal interest.
Spring into Color: Nature’s Grand Performance
Blue Elf Aloe (Aloe x ‘Blue Elf’) – A hardy succulent with orange blooms from winter through late spring, it thrives in rocky gardens.
Desert Willow (Chilopsis linearis) – This deciduous tree produces pink-to-fuchsia flowers from late spring through fall, attracting pollinators and creating a soft, airy feel.
Claret Cup Cactus (Echinocereus triglochidiatus) – This evergreen cactus stuns with bright red to orange blooms from mid-spring through summer, making it a bold addition to any xeriscape.
Summer & Fall: A Desert Oasis of Color
Beavertail Cactus (Opuntia basilaris) – This evergreen cactus produces pink-to-magenta flowers sporadically throughout the year, ensuring color even in the hottest months.
Sandia Grow Red Yucca (Hesperaloe parviflora Sandia Grow) – This evergreen favorite keeps things lively with red-to-pink blooms from spring through fall—a hummingbird magnet!
